I. About XMU
Xiamen University (XMU) was founded in 1921 by the renowned patriotic overseas Chinese leader Mr. Tan Kah Kee with the vision of becoming “a university for the world.” Since its inception, it has embodied the spirit of “pursuing excellence and striving for perfection,” cultivating a rich cultural heritage and fostering an academic environment dedicated to exceptional teaching and research. The University has steadfastly upheld Mr. Tan’s founding principles and promoted its esteemed ethos of “patriotism, progressiveness, self-improvement, and science.” Over the years, it has been designated a National Key University and included in China’s “Project 211,” “Project 985,” and the national “Double First-Class” initiative.
Following more than a century of robust growth, XMU has evolved into a comprehensive institution with a full spectrum of disciplines, a distinguished faculty, and a leading position in China alongside its broad international influence, solidifying its status as an ideal venue for nurturing talent and pioneering scientific research.
II. Postdoctoral Fellowship Programs at XMU
XMU was among the first institutions in China authorized to establish postdoctoral research centers. Acknowledging postdoctoral fellows as a key source of future academic leaders and faculty members, the University currently operates 36 such centers spanning a wide range of disciplines, including the humanities, social sciences, natural sciences, engineering, medicine, economics, management, and law. These centers are supported by a comprehensive and integrated training framework.
XMU boasts an eminent team of collaborative supervisors, led by academicians of the Chinese Academy of Sciences (CAS) and the Chinese Academy of Engineering (CAE), along with other nationally recognized high-level experts. They provide postdoctoral researchers with high-caliber academic guidance. A testament to this mentorship is that some former postdoctoral fellows have advanced to become academicians of the CAS, or have taken on influential roles as leading scholars, principal investigators, and key academic figures at top universities and research institutions in China and abroad. This sustained cycle of talent cultivation and succession reflects the University’s robust and dynamic academic ecosystem.
III. Eligibility Criteria
Applicants must:
1. Demonstrate strong ethical character, academic integrity, and sound physical and mental health;
2. Be generally no older than 35 years of age;
3. Have received their doctoral degree within the past three years;
4. Meet any additional entry requirements set by the specific postdoctoral research center.
IV. Support Policies
1. A competitive package is provided, including an annual salary, housing provident fund, and social insurance. Regular postdoctoral fellows receive a base annual compensation starting from RMB 180,000, while project-based postdoctoral fellows are offered between RMB 240,000 and RMB 440,000 annually. Eligible individuals may also receive additional municipal subsidies in accordance with Xiamen city policies.
2. Qualified postdoctoral fellows may apply for the evaluation and appointment to professional technical positions, such as Assistant Researcher or Associate Researcher, in compliance with relevant regulations.
3. The University supports postdoctoral fellows in undertaking academic exchange programs at internationally renowned universities and research institutions.
4. Postdoctoral apartments are available on campus, with convenient access to kindergarten and supermarket facilities. Fellows who choose not to reside in university housing are eligible for a monthly housing allowance.
5. Postdoctoral fellows are entitled to the same benefits as regular faculty members, including annual health check-ups, supplementary mutual medical insurance, and holiday welfare packages provided by the University Faculty Union.
6. The University offers support in securing kindergarten placements and primary/secondary school enrollment for the children of postdoctoral fellows.
V. Application Procedure
1. Contact a prospective supervisor to discuss research alignment and secure preliminary agreement;
2. Reach out to the secretary of the relevant postdoctoral research center to submit formal application materials;
3. Undergo institutional review and national registration;
4. Complete onboarding formalities upon approval.
